#pragma once
/**
*
* The RC struct helps having a structure referenced by multiple concurrent threads
* released when nobody uses it anymore.
*
*/
#include <dnscore/mutex.h>
#ifdef __cplusplus
extern "C"
{
#endif
typedef void rc_free_method(void*);
struct rc_vtbl
{
rc_free_method *free_callback;
mutex_t *mtx;
};
typedef struct rc_vtbl rc_vtbl;
/**
* Initialises an RC vtbl.
* The callback is called to free the struct when its last reference is released.
* The mutex is meant to be shared trough a struct type.
*
* @param spvtbl
* @param free_callback
* @param mtx
*/
void rc_init_vtbl(rc_vtbl *spvtbl, rc_free_method *free_callback, mutex_t *mtx);
void rc_finalise_vtbl(rc_vtbl *spvtbl);
struct rc_s
{
rc_vtbl *vtbl;
s32 count;
};
typedef struct rc_s rc_s;
/**
* struct whatever
* {
* RC_COUNTER;
* int brol;
* };
*
* alloc:
* struct whatever *w = malloc & create & cie;
* rc_acquire(w);
* return w;
*
* get:
* rc_acquire(w);
* return w;
*
*
* rc_release(w);
* w = NULL;
*
*/
#define RC_COUNTER struct rc_s __reference_counter
void rc_set_internal(rc_s *rc, rc_vtbl *vtbl);
void rc_aquire_internal(rc_s *rc);
void rc_release_internal(rc_s *rc, void *data);
#define rc_set(__structptr__, spvtbl) \
rc_set_internal((__structptr__), &((__structptr__)->__reference_counter));
/**
* The typical place of an rc_acquire is before returning the variable.
*/
#define rc_aquire(__structptr__, spvtbl) \
rc_aquire_internal(&((__struct_ptr__)->__reference_counter))
/**
* An rc_release SHOULD be followed by the variable being set to NULL.
*/
#define rc_release(__struct_ptr__) \
rc_release_internal(&((__struct_ptr__)->__reference_counter), (__struct_ptr__))
